The MERV 13 filters are Certified Green Filters. They help business's and
contractors who are trying to receive LEED Certification from the U.S.
Green Building Council (USGBC). The Multi-Pleat Green 13 carries a
MERV 13 fractional efficiency rating in accordance with ASHRAE test
standard 52.2. The MERV 13 efficiency rating meets the air filtration
efficiency criteria required to earn points toward certification in the
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design (LEED) Green Building
Rating System. They have static charges which collect more particles.
When the charge runs out it works at normal efficiency (MERV 8).
HIGH CAPACITY AND STANDARD CAPACITY FILTERS
Technical Terms:
The new MERV 8 Pre-Pleated 40 filter features a filtering medium that is more efficient AND
ecologically friendly. Made entirely from recycled materials, this
media achieves MERV 8 efficiency with a low resistance to air flow.
It is also unaffected by high humidity and is hydrophobic (non moisture
absorbing). Pre-Pleat 40 Filters can upgrade existing flat panel
filters as well as a MERV 6 or 7 pleated filters currently being used
with little increase in resistance. Available in 1, 2 and 4 inch
depths, standard and high capacity versions. All Pre-Pleat 40 Filters
are 30 to 35% efficient by ASHRAE 52.1-92 and MERV 8. These filters
are suitable for variable air volume systems. Operating face velocity
ranges are from 0 to 500 fpm for 1 inch and 2 inch filters and from 0
to 625 fpm for 4 inch filters.
Easy Terms:
This is a 3 month filter. MERV rating of 8, 11 or 13. The difference
between the High Capacity and the Standard Capacity is the amount of
pleats each filter has. The High Capacity filter has more pleats then
the Standard Capacity filter does which gives you more filtration space
and better air flow. The MERV rating or Minimum Efficiency Rating
Value simply tells you how good the filter is as far as efficiency with
NIOSH.
